Our client is looking for an experienced and motivated Site Set-Up Paralegal to join their highly regarded Residential Development team. In this role, you’ll act for leading housebuilder clients, playing an integral part in the set-up of new residential sites and ensuring a seamless process from acquisition through to plot sales. You’ll have the opportunity for daily client interaction, working closely with both clients and colleagues to deliver exceptional service. This position is ideal for someone who enjoys a fast-paced, supportive environment and wants to make a real impact within a successful and forward-thinking property team.
We’re looking for someone with prior experience in site set-up within a residential development or property team. You’ll be detail-oriented, proactive, and confident in managing client relationships. You will demonstrate:
- Excellent attention to detail and high levels of accuracy
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- The ability to work effectively as part of a team and deliver outstanding client service
- A professional and conscientious approach to your work
- Confidence engaging with clients and colleagues at all levels
